When we have an IUD that comes from the pharmacy, we have typically billed out the J code with a zero charge and the insertion. Would there be an issue with payers paying the insertion if a J code is not billed?
 
No, we bill the insertion only when the IUD is a pharmacy device and have not had any denials with that specific issue.
